I have most of the GSA programs.

I do not aim for high LPM, and I use GSA SER directly on money sites. I only get around 250 - 500 links per day, but that is what I am aiming for. For captcha solving I am using GSA Captha Breaker and no other service. For proxies I am using the scanner in SER. For scraping I use a combination of SER and Scrapebox with the SER footprints. I do not use paid lists.

Contrary to common advise, my experience is that SER scrapes more postable URLs than Scrapebox does. However, this could be the setting that I am using.

As an experiment, I am using a list I scraped of roughly 9,000,000 urls scraped with Scrapebox from Bing and Google, and posting to them via GScraper. For this I am using GSA Proxy Scraper to find the proxies, and using CB for captcha solving. GScraper is setup to skip posts if there are more than 25 OBL. In 12 hours 679,000 urls have been attempted to have been posted to, while 10,434 have been successful. I do not recommend that others use GScraper, and there are many reasons.

By way of contrast, I used a somewhat similar list and posted with SER. Out of 3 million URLs, there were only a few hundred successful posts. What does this mean? Absolutely nothing. GScraper posts garbage links to any unauthenticated form while SER post to authenticated forms.

So yes, GSA SER does work, or rather it will do the drudge work for you while requiring you to do the heavy lifting by using your mind to set it up. I limit any post made by GSA to less than 25 OBL and still get 250 - 500 links per day. But the difference is that I have experimented and found what works for the niches I post to.
